密码编码与信息安全——C++实践
✍ Scribed by 王静文; 吴晓艺
- Publisher
- 清华大学出版社
- Year
- 2015
- Tongue
- Chinese
- Leaves
- 356
- Category
- Library
No coin nor oath required. For personal study only.
✦ Synopsis
本书主要介绍了密码编码学与信息安全的常用算法所涉及的理论,并介绍了使用C++语言实现这些算法的基本过程与具体实现。本书涵盖了古典密码、对称密钥算法、公钥算法、散列函数和数字签名等几部分内容,并在每章最后附有一定量的习题与实践题供读者练习。本书可以作为信息安全、信息与计算科学、计算机科学技术、通信工程等专业的本科生教材,也可以为从事信息安全、通信、电子工程等领域的技术人员提供参考。
✦ Table of Contents
封面
扉页
内容简介
版权页
前言
目录
第1章 概述
1.1 密码学简介
1.2 信息安全遇到的威胁
1.3 密码编码和信息安全提供的服务
1.4 习题
第1部分 古典密码
第2章 古典密码编码技术
第2部分 现代对称密码
第3章 S-DES算法
第4章 DES算法
第5章 AES算法
第6章 IDEA算法
第7章 Blowfish算法
第8章 CAST-128算法
第9章 分组密码模式
第10章 A5算法
第11章 RC4算法
第12章 RC5算法
第13章 RC6算法
第3部分 公钥密码算法
第14章 RSA算法
第15章 Diffie-Hellman密钥交换算法
第16章 Elgamal加密算法
第4部分 散列函数
第17章 MD4算法与MD5算法
第18章 SHA-1算法
第19章 RIPEMD-160算法
第5部分 数字签名
第20章 数字签名
正文结束
参考文献
📜 SIMILAR VOLUMES
书签已装载, 书签制作方法请找 [email protected] 完全免费 信息论、错误控制编码和密码学是现代数字通信系统中的三大支柱,《信息论、编码与密码学(第2版)》用有限的篇幅将三者中所有重要的概念有机地结合起来,涉及信息论、信源编码、信道编码和密码学等方面的知识,不仅内容丰富,而且技术深度适当。《信息论、编码与密码学(第2版)》适合作为高等院校信息安全、电子工程及相关专业信息论和编码课程的教材,从事相关工作的专业技术人员也能从中受益。
<p>本书系统地介绍了密码编码学与网络安全的基本原理和应用技术。全书分六部分:背景知识部分介绍信息与网络安全概念、数论基础;对称密码部分讨论传统加密技术、分组密码和数据加密标准、有限域、高级加密标准、分组加密工作模式、随机位生成和流密码;非对称密码部分讨论公钥密码学与RSA、其他公钥密码体制;密码学数据完整性算法部分讨论密码学哈希函数、消息认证码、数字签名、轻量级密码和后量子密码;互信部分讨论密钥管理和分发、用户认证;网络和因特网安全部分讨论传输层安全、无线网络安全、电子邮件安全、IP安全、网络端点安全、云计算、物联网安全。附录A讨论线性代数的基本概念,附录B讨论保密性和安全性度量,附录C介绍
<p>《密码学与编码理论(第2版)》是密码学方面的经典著作,是作者对其多年教学经验的总结。书中主要内容包括数论、数据加密标准(DES)、高级加密标准Rijndael、RSA算法、离散对数、散列函数、信息论、格方法、纠错码以及量子密码等,其中许多内容都反映了业内的新进展。《密码学与编码理论(第2版)》配有大量实例、习题以及用Mathematica(r)、Maple(r)、MATLAB(r)编写的上机练习。</p>